Costa Rica’s Kolbi launches LTE 4G service

Kolbi, the mobile division of Costa Rica’s state-owned operator ICEhas launched a 4G mobile internet service across nearly a third of the Central American country.

The LTE Network will support post-paid customers, and two packages are being made available with sppeds upto 6Mbps and 10 Mbps.The 10 Mbps service will be free for one month to those who request it in the next 15 days. The 4G internet service is not yet available for the iPhone 5, 5S and 5C models, due to a pending software update by Apple.
